His writing invites reflection on how the past continues to influence present cultural landscapes.\u003c\/p\u003e","products":[{"product_id":"finding-shakespeares-new-place-by-william-mitchell-9781526106490","title":"Finding Shakespeare's New Place","description":"\u003cdiv class=\"book-description\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This ground-breaking book provides an abundance of fresh insights into Shakespeare's life in relation to his lost family home, \u003cem\u003eNew Place\u003c\/em\u003e. The findings of a major archaeological excavation encourage us to think again about what \u003cem\u003eNew Place\u003c\/em\u003e meant to Shakespeare and, in so doing, challenge some of the long-held assumptions of Shakespearian biography.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cem\u003eNew Place\u003c\/em\u003e was the largest house in the borough and the only one with a courtyard. Shakespeare was only ever an intermittent lodger in London. His impressive home gave Shakespeare significant social status and was crucial to his relationship with Stratford-upon-Avon.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eArchaeology helps to inform biography in this innovative and refreshing study which presents an overview of the site from prehistoric times through to a richly nuanced reconstruction of \u003cem\u003eNew Place\u003c\/em\u003e when Shakespeare and his family lived there, and beyond.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eThis attractively illustrated book is for anyone with a passion for archaeology or Shakespeare.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e","brand":"Hachette Aotearoa New Zealand","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":47596407292140,"sku":"9781526106490","price":58.99,"currency_code":"NZD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0705\/7784\/8556\/files\/9781526106490-finding-shakespeare-s-new-place.jpg?v=1777924258"}],"url":"https:\/\/bookhero.co.nz\/collections\/kevin-colls.oembed","provider":"Book Hero","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
